Actually, my preferred top insulation in summer is either a fleece blanket or a poncho liner (woobie). I know that I'm more likely to sweat during the summer...and just haven't felt comfortable with spending that much on a down TQ that's likely to suck up a lot of sweat. I can wash my woobie after every trip and not worry about whether or not I'm going to destroy it. And it's < $30 if I do. I'll take the weight penalty to save my piece of mind.

I use a HG 40° Burrow with 2oz of overfill & snap footbox. In its stuff sack it weighs 15.07oz (427.2g). I bought it last year right after HG began offering the Argon material. You could only get the Argon on the inner shell then so it has whatever material they were using before the Argon as the outer shell material.
